Ballroom Dance Instruction by Kyle and Susan Webb, March 12, 2001
This review is from: Ballroom Dancing [VHS] (VHS Tape)
To those people who are looking for excellent instruction and not hurried or rushed from one phase of the dance instruction to another, these are the videos for you. The dance steps are gone over quite a few times, both for the men and women and executed slowly so you can understand the instruction in an excellent way. Tressa Mason has excellent videos that I also have, but her instruction is not for the average or slow learner. They are fine if you are an experienced dancer, then I say use Tressa's videos. BUT if you are starting out in ballroom dancing and / or brushing up on steps than Kyle and Susan Webb's are the videos to use.

Good, and certainly worth the reasonable price, May 19, 2000
By A Customer
This review is from: Ballroom Dancing [VHS] (VHS Tape)
Good instruction, very easy to follow (if anything, some of the moves are overexplained). It's too bad that these tapes aren't grouped by dance type instead of user level. It'd be easier to practice a certain style without switching tapes all the time. Are they smooth dancers? Not really. Competent, but stiff. Is the oldies type stuff what you associate with Waltz and Rumba? No. However, the important thing is that they teach you and these tapes are great for clearly learning some moves. I find these tapes much better than those by Teresa Mason for learning, although Mason's dancing is certainly superior. We had the Mason tape first, and have found that the Webb's tapes have made it much easier to understand what Mason and her partner are actually doing.
